Of course, the original Dynamic Gold has evolved into a wide variety of ... WebJan 18, 2024 · Dynamic Gold “wedge flex”. Matching exactly the same shaft in your irons to your wedges. A slightly heavier shaft in your wedges. Putting an 8-iron shaft in your wedges. Using a wedge-specific shaft. During an iron fitting, we see a lot of variables in flight and feel, this is mainly because we use 6-irons as our demo clubs.
